摘要

[Problem] To provide a system whereby it is possible to effect a motivation for energy conservation by a comparison to other persons. [Solution] Provided is an energy conservation promotion performance evaluation device, in which: a population constituent user identification information acquisition unit comprises a population constituent group identification information acquisition means which acquires population constituent group identification information which acquires, as a collective comparison subject, a group which is identified by group identification information which identifies a group and which is configured from a plurality of instances of user identification information as comparison subjects; and an energy conservation promotion performance evaluation result acquisition unit comprises a group energy conservation promotion performance evaluation result acquisition means which acquires, as an energy conservation promotion performance evaluation result, energy consumption performance data of a group which is identified with the population constituent group identification information which has been acquired by the population constituent group identification information acquisition means, associating said energy consumption performance data with the group identification information on the basis of a retained energy conservation evaluation rule.
